Energy Unit        Equivalent

  • 10 therms of dry natural gas
  • 11 gallons of propane
  • 2 months of the dietary intake of a laborer

1 quadrillion BTU of energy        45 million short tons of coal

  • 60 million short tons of oven-dried hardwood
  • 1 trillion cubic feet of dry natural gas
  • 170 million barrels of crude oil
  • 470 thousand barrels of crude oil per day for 1 year

1 barrel of crude oil        5.6 thousand cubic feet of dry natural gas

  • 0.26 short tons (520 pounds) of coal
  • 1,700 kilowatt-hours of electricity

1 short ton of coal        3.8 barrels of crude oil

  • 21,000 cubic feet of dry natural gas
  • 6,500 kilowatt-hours of electricity

1,000 cubic feet of natural gas        0.18 barrels (7.4 gallons) of crude oil

  • 0.05 short tons (93 pounds) of coal
  • 300 kilowatt-hours of electricity

1,000 kilowatt-hours of electricity 0.59 barrels of crude oil

  • 0.15 short tons (310 pounds) of coal
  • 3,300 cubic feet of dry natural gas

Notes: One quadrillion equals 1,000,000,000,000,000. One therm equals 100,000 BTUs.
